记录些常用的hexo使用方法,至于怎么安装和配置hexo就不写了,网上很多教程,这里只是记录下常用的使用方法
1.新建文章
hexo n "新文章名"
== hexo new "新文章名"
例如:使用hexo n hello
命令创建一篇文章,hexo会默认在source/_posts
目录下面给你创建一个名为hello.md
的文件。如果文件名有空格注意加””。注意:文章名字是取决于文件里面title
的配置,而不是这个hello
,所以新建的时候可以写简单点的文件名,之后再在里面title
更改文章标题
2.生成静态文件
hexo g
== hexo generate
生成网站静态文件到默认设置的public
文件夹。便于查看网站生成的静态文件或者手动部署网站;如果是自动部署,不需要先执行该命令
3.启动本地服务器
hexo s
== hexo server
启动本地服务器,用于预览博客。默认地址: http://localhost:4000/ 。预览的同时可以修改文章内容或主题代码,保存后刷新页面即可。如果更改_config.yml
,则需要重启本地服务
4.清除缓存
hexo c
== hexo clean
清除缓存文件db.json
和已生成的静态文件public
。网站显示异常时可以执行这条命令试试。
5.部署到git仓库
hexo d
== hexo deploy
自动生成网站静态文件,并部署到设定的仓库。
6.草稿
hexo p
== hexo publish
Hexo提供草稿功能,在_drafts
目录下的文章不会发表到网站上,你可以通过命令hexo publish "文章名"
发布你的草稿,改命令会将文章移到_posts
目录下。但是也可以设置_config.yml
配置文件的render_drafts
字段,使草稿默认发布到站点中。
7.报错
|
|
解决方法npm install hexo-deployer-git --save
8.文章格式
hexo文章格式是基于Markdown语法的,详情参考以下网页https://www.zybuluo.com/mdeditor
正文中可以使用 <!--more-->
设置文章摘要 如下:
以上是文章摘要
<!--more-->
以下是余下全文